Summitt's fire and burn crews
can perform a number of wildland fire activities, including:
- Pile Burning
- Broadcast Burning
- Line Construction
- Fire Suppression
Summitt's crews are qualified under NWCG
Standards and are strictly monitored by our fire management
staff. Our crews are safe, efficient, professional and able to perform
duties all over the U.S.
Our resources include:
- 5 - Type 2 20 person suppression and burn
crews
- 3 - Type 6 (300 gallon) wildfire engines
- 1 - Type 2 (2500 gallon) water tender
- 1 - John Deere 550G dozer
- 40 - drip torches for burning
Summitt also can supply qualified Burn Bosses to
meet your needs. We have Type 2 and Type 3 Burn Bosses and a number
of Ignition, Holding, and Mop-up Specialists. We also have a prescribed
fire planner at our disposal to author, edit and/or administer burn
plans.
